As we hit Friday, that means the first weekend of the 2021 college football season is here! And getting things rolling on Saturday will be a B1G West battle between Illinois and Nebraska.
That contest carries plenty of intrigue. The Illini enter Year 1 under new head coach Bret Bielema while the Huskers are hoping for a turnaround in Year 4 with Scott Frost.
The game in Champaign will be the biggest of Week 0 though a couple of other contests will go down around the country. The rest of the slate for Week 0 includes the MEAC/SWAC Challenge in Atlanta while Hawaii and UCLA will square off in California.
Below is a look at the broadcast teams and channels for every Week 0 contest, courtesy of Eye on Sky and Air Sports:
Saturday, August 28
- 1 pm EST – Nebraska at Illinois – FOX: Joe Davis, Brock Huard, Bruce Feldman; Compass Media: Gregg Daniels, Chad Brown
- 2 pm EST – UConn at Fresno State – CBSSN: Rich Waltz, Aaron Taylor, Jenny Dell
- 3:30 pm EST – Hawaii at UCLA – ESPN: Beth Mowins, Kirk Morrison, Dawn Davenport; Westwood One: Paul Burmeister, Ryan Leaf
- 6 pm EST – Eastern Illinois at Indiana State – ESPN+: Brian Jennings, Katrell Moss
- 7 pm EST – MEAC/SWAC Challenge: Alcorn State vs. North Carolina Central – ESPN: Mark Jones, Jay Walker, Robert Griffin III, Quint Kessenich, Tiffany Greene
- 9:30 pm EST – UTEP at New Mexico State – AggieVision, FloFootball: Adam Young, Danny Knee, Stephanie Shields
- 10 pm EST – Southern Utah at San Jose State – CBSSN: Jason Knapp, Aaron Murray, Amanda Guerra
